Leo's Burger Barn is a cozy eatery nestled in Arp, TX, known for serving up delicious burgers and classic American comfort food.
With a casual and inviting atmosphere, Leo's Burger Barn offers a menu filled with tasty options for those looking to enjoy a satisfying meal in a laid-back setting.
Generated from their business information